Can formatted SSD data be recovered?
Yes, formatted SSD data can be recovered, but it depends heavily on whether the TRIM command was executed. If TRIM is active, the drive purges deleted blocks automatically, making recovery highly difficult. However, if the formatting was quick, TRIM was disabled, or the drive is external, professional recovery is highly successful.
Detailed Explanation: Solid State Drives (SSDs) manage data differently than traditional Hard Disk Drives (HDDs). When an HDD is formatted, the file pointers are deleted, but the actual data remains on the magnetic platters until overwritten.
Examples: A business accidentally formats a Samsung T7 external SSD containing critical financial records. Because it is an external drive connected via USB, the TRIM command is often not executed by default. Lifeguard Data Recovery can extract 100% of the lost files. Conversely, if an internal NVMe SSD undergoes a full operating system reinstallation, TRIM clears the blocks within minutes, necessitating immediate specialized forensic imaging.

How Does RAID Recovery Work?
RAID recovery works by reconstructing data across multiple storage drives using the array’s original configuration parameters, such as block size, drive order, and parity maps. Engineers bypass failed hardware controllers, image each drive independently, and virtually reassemble the array to extract files.
Detailed Explanation: RAID (Redundant Array of Independent Disks) systems distribute data across multiple hard drives or SSDs for speed or redundancy. When a RAID array crashes due to multiple drive failures, controller corruption, or accidental formatting, standard recovery software fails because it cannot understand the distributed data chunks. Professional RAID recovery requires extracting bit-by-bit clones of every individual drive within the system. Engineers then analyze the raw hex data to determine the precise stripe size, rotation pattern, and disk sequence, allowing them to emulate the controller configuration in software and rebuild the file system cleanly.

Can Deleted Files Be Recovered?
Yes, deleted files can be recovered provided the storage blocks containing those files have not been overwritten by new data. When a file is deleted, the operating system simply marks its storage space as available, leaving the actual data intact until new data claims the space.
Detailed Explanation: File deletion removes the file’s index pointer in the file system architecture (such as NTFS, APFS, or exFAT). The underlying binary data remains perfectly preserved on the disk platters or flash storage cells. However, regular system activity, web browsing, and automated updates constantly write new information to the drive, which can permanently overwrite these marked blocks. For traditional hard drives, recovery is highly predictable. For SSDs, immediate power-down is mandatory to prevent internal firmware processes from clearing the data blocks automatically.

How Much Does Data Recovery Cost in UAE?
Data recovery costs in the UAE vary based on the device type, the nature of the damage (logical corruption vs. physical mechanical failure), and the required turnaround time. Prices range from minor logical fixes to complex laboratory cleanroom reconstructions, with free diagnostics provided upfront.
Detailed Explanation: Data recovery pricing cannot be accurately flat-rated because every recovery scenario presents completely different engineering challenges. Logical recoveries (such as accidental formatting, software glitches, or deleted files) require specialized software reconstruction and take fewer hours. Physical failures (such as clicking hard drives, blown circuit boards, or burnt SSD controllers) demand cleanroom physical disassembly, donor parts matching, and firmware micro-soldering, which increases the labor and infrastructure requirements.
Examples: A standard accidental deletion on a external USB flash drive represents a lower-cost logical recovery. A flooded, mechanically seized 8-drive enterprise server array requires cleanroom micro-component replacement on all drives, falling into the highest tier of engineering costs.

How Long Does Recovery Take?
Standard data recovery takes between 2 to 5 business days, while emergency cases can be completed within 24 to 48 hours. The precise timeline depends heavily on the physical health of the media and the total storage volume being extracted.
Detailed Explanation: The recovery timeline consists of three distinct phases: initial diagnostics, the actual stabilization/extraction process, and data verification. If a drive is physically stable, data can be transferred at the maximum mechanical speed of the storage media. However, if a hard drive has damaged read/write heads or degraded media surfaces, the drive must be cloned at highly controlled, slow speeds using industrial imaging stations to prevent complete media destruction, which extends the processing timeline.
Examples: A logically formatted SSD can often be evaluated and recovered within 24 hours. A severely physically degraded hard drive that requires multiple donor head replacements and slow sector-by-sector extraction may take up to 5 business days to safely complete.

Common Causes of Data Loss
Data loss occurs across UAE enterprises and consumer devices due to several distinct environmental, human, and system issues:
Accidental Formatting and Deletion: Human error remains the leading cause of data emergencies, often involving accidental partition deletion or disk wiping during OS updates.
Firmware and Software Corruption: Unexpected system crashes, uncompleted firmware installations, or file system corruption render storage volumes completely unreadable.
Physical and Mechanical Failure: Dropped laptops, worn-out read/write heads, electrical power surges, and seized drive motors completely halt standard storage access.
Environmental Damage: Extreme heat, high humidity, and unexpected water exposure can short-circuit delicate electronic components or ruin internal platters.
Malware and Ransomware Attacks: Malicious cyber attacks encrypt system data or intentionally damage partition tables to disrupt business workflows.

What Impacts Recovery Success?
The probability of a successful file recovery depends heavily on the actions taken immediately following a data loss incident:
Immediate Power-Down: Keeping a failed drive powered off prevents physical friction damage to platters and stops SSD background self-wiping routines.
The TRIM Command State: If an SSD has TRIM enabled and remains powered on after formatting, the success rate drops significantly compared to an immediate shutdown.
Previous Recovery Attempts: Running cheap internet recovery utilities on failing hardware can cause permanent physical scratches or overwrite data blocks, reducing success rates.
Physical Condition: Drives with intact media platters or clean NAND flash chips yield significantly higher recovery yields than cracked or severely burnt silicon components.

Expert Tips
Stop Using the Device Immediately: The absolute moment you suspect data loss, disconnect the device. Do not install any utility software or save new files.
Avoid DIY Software on Clicking Drives: If a hard drive makes clicking, grinding, or buzzing noises, software cannot fix it. Powering it on will cause permanent media destruction.
Check External SSD Compatibility: External solid-state media often lacks active TRIM support over basic USB bridges, giving you a massive advantage for recovery if you act quickly.
Implement a 3-2-1 Backup Plan: Maintain three distinct copies of your data across two different media formats, with at least one secure backup stored offsite or in a cloud environment.

Is data recovery possible after formatting?
Yes, data recovery remains highly possible after formatting, especially if a Quick Format was executed instead of a Full Format or low-level sanitization. A quick format simply overwrites the file system index while leaving your actual data blocks intact until new files fill that space.
Can a clicking hard drive be repaired and recovered?
Yes, a clicking hard drive can be successfully recovered inside an authorized cleanroom environment by replacing damaged internal components like read/write head assemblies or preamplifier chips. Never run software on a clicking drive, as the broken components will permanently scrape and ruin the data platters.
Can a water-damaged server be recovered?
Yes, water-damaged servers are recoverable if the internal storage media undergoes proper laboratory decontamination and chemical drying before power is applied. Our specialists disassemble the drives, clean away corrosion, treat components, and image the raw data sectors using specialized hardware tools.
What should I do if my NAS stops recognizing its drives?
If your network-attached storage array stops recognizing its drives, turn off the system immediately and avoid rebuilding or re-initializing the array. Forcing a rebuild on a unstable, failing drive can permanently corrupt the remaining files and damage the parity architecture beyond repair.

Can data be recovered from a burnt SSD?
Yes, data can be recovered from an SSD that has suffered severe electrical burns or component shorts by transferring the working NAND flash storage chips onto a matching donor circuit board.<span class=””> This process requires precise micro-soldering expertise and specialized industrial chip-reading hardware.
Why does software fail to recover formatted SSD data?
Commercial recovery software fails on formatted SSDs because standard operating systems block the software from reading storage sectors that have been flagged by the TRIM command. Professional hardware imagers bypass the OS entirely, communicating directly with the raw controller chip to extract data blocks.
